PSALMS. Chapter 95. Come ye, make ye full out joy to the Lord; heartily sing we to God, our health. Before-occupy we his face in acknowledging; and heartily sing we to him in psalms. For God is a great Lord, and a great King above all gods; for the Lord shall not put away his people. For all the ends of the earth be in his hand; and the highness, or the heights, of hills be his. For the sea is his, and he made it; and his hands formed the dry land. Come ye, praise we, and fall we down before God; weep we before the Lord that made us; for he is our Lord God. And we be the people of his pasture; and the sheep of his hand. If ye have heard his voice today; do not ye make hard your hearts. As in the stirring to wrath; by the day of temptation in desert. Where your fathers tempted me; they proved and saw my works. Forty years I was offended to this generation; and I said, Evermore they err in heart. And these men knew not my ways; to whom I swore in mine ire, they shall not enter into my rest.
